BUG-3128: Pagination endpoints on the Fernbrook public REST API return 403 after the gateway upgrade — signature check on the cursor token fails for page two and beyond. First page works because it carries no cursor. Likely cause: gateway verifying cursors against the retired key. Fix: update the verifier config and redeploy the gateway. The deploy key you need is below.

signing key of bagap-yawep = bky13_TbfT6ZMUoGJo2

### Runbook: Billing worker blue-green deploy

The Lanternpay billing worker runs as two identical stacks, blue and green. Deploy the new build to the idle stack, run the smoke suite, then shift traffic with the weighted router in 25% steps. Keep the previous stack warm for one hour in case of rollback. Artifacts must be signed before the router will accept them, and the router validates against the deploy key below.

rollout seal: bky4_x7Gc

Subject: Key rotation for InvoiceForge renderer

Welcome, new folks. Every quarter we rotate the credential the Pellworth PDF invoice renderer uses to call our internal asset service, Vaultline. The old key stops working Friday at noon. Update your local .env and the staging config before then, and verify a test invoice renders with the new embedded fonts. For convenience, the freshly issued key is included here.

app token of bagef-bageg = kto11_vuwA0uhrEMg

Quick rundown for the sales leads on the Tessellate licensing dispute. As you know, Kelbrook Media claims our reseller terms let them sublicense the Tessellate suite; our counsel disagrees. Legal costs ran higher than expected this quarter, and we've set aside a modest reserve just in case. Revenue impact so far: minimal, though two renewals in the Marwick territory are paused. Keep pipeline conversations steady and don't speculate with clients. One more thing worth flagging before you dig into accounts this week.

board note of fafog-yahap: Project Rusdor slips by a full year because of the audit delay.

## Onboarding: Stormglass Alert Fan-out

For security review: Stormglass ingests regional weather feeds and fans alerts out to subscriber shards via the Gustline relay. Each shard has its own scoped credential; nothing shares tokens across regions. Delivery is at-least-once with dedup at the edge. To inspect fan-out traffic in staging, the relay authenticates with the key below.

gateway credential: kto3_qfe